kochi, kerala

Kochi is known for its diversity and eclecticism. It is one of the major cities on the Kerala coast and has a population of about 1.4 million. Here you can find the oldest church in India, small streets full of mosques and 500-year-old Portuguese houses, cantilevered Chinese fishing nets, an ancient and still living Jewish community, a 16th century synagogue, and a Portuguese palace that was given to a raja. It really is a very interesting place. We stayed in the older area known as Fort Cochin where there was, at one point, a fort.

The narrow little streets are quite charming and we walked around a lot.
